Tamil protestors hold protest in Delhi, demand immediate constitution of Cauvery Management Board
|
|
|||
Tamil protestors hold protest in Delhi, demand immediate constitution of Cauvery Management Board Show more
Tamil protestors hold protest in Delhi, demand immediate constitution of Cauvery Management Board Show less
Embed: Hide

© 2025 Rediff.com - 
Comments